The Kerala Story 2: Goes Beyond collected Rs. 1.25 crore on its second Thursday, maintaining a steady run at the box office. The movie added Rs. 12.65 crore to the tally in its Week 2, recording a 35 per cent dip from the opening week. This takes its two-week cume to Rs. 32.90 crore nett. at the box office.
Directed by Kamakhya Narayan Singh, starring Ulka Gupta, Aishwarya Ojha, and Aditi Bhatia, the film will cross the Rs. 35 crore mark on its third Saturday and will wrap its weekend around Rs. 37 crore or so. The Kerala Story 2 will have a shortened third week, as Dhurandhar 2 is releasing with Wednesday previews, which will kick all the holdover releases out of the cinemas. By then, the movie is likely to reach the Rs. 40 crore nett. mark.
When compared to the first film, the box office run of the sequel is nowhere near as good; however, whatever the movie is minting is commendable for a no-face value film. The original film was a blockbuster, which opened to Rs. 6.75 crore and went on to collect Rs. 220 crore nett in its full run. A couple of films in this zone saw huge success in the early 2020s, but since then, they have seen a fall off. For instance, The Bengal Files plummeted from The Kashmir Files. The Kashmir Files 2 will also see a big drop from the original, but will do well for its costs.
The Box Office Collections for The Kerala Story 2: Goes Beyond in India are as follows:
Day
Nett
Friday
Rs. 0.65 cr.
Saturday
Rs. 4.50 cr.
Sunday
Rs. 4.50 cr.
Monday
Rs. 2.00 cr.
Tuesday
Rs. 3.50 cr.
Wednesday
Rs. 3.00 cr.
Thursday
Rs. 2.10 cr.
2nd Friday
Rs. 1.75 cr.
2nd Saturday
Rs. 3.00 cr.
2nd Sunday
Rs. 2.50 cr.
2nd Monday
Rs. 1.25 cr.
2nd Tuesday
Rs. 1.65 cr.
2nd Wednesday
Rs. 1.25 cr. (est.)
2nd Thursday
Rs. 1.25 cr. (est.)
Total
Rs. 32.90 cr.
